Greensmaster 3300/3400 Page 6 -- 17 Electrical System
Starting Problems
Problem Possible Causes
Starter solenoid clicks, but starter will not crank
(if solenoid clicks, problem is not in safety interlock
system).
Battery cables are loose or corroded.
Battery ground to frame is loose or corroded.
Battery is discharged or faulty.
Wiring at starter is loose or faulty.
Starter mounting bolts are loose or not supplying a
sufficient ground.
Starter solenoid is faulty.
Starter motor is faulty.
Nothing happens when start attempt is made. Functional control lever is not in the NEUTRAL
position.
The parking brake is disengaged and the operator seat
is unoccupied.
Battery cables are loose or corroded.
Battery ground to frame is loose or corroded.
Battery is discharged or faulty.
Fuse(s) is (are) faulty.
The fusible link harness at the engine starter motor is
faulty.
Wiring to the s tart circuit components is loose,
corroded or damaged (see electrical schematic in
Chapter 10 -- Foldout Drawings).
The ignition switch or circuit w iring is faulty.
Starter solenoid or circuit wiring is faulty.
Main power relay or circuit wiring is faulty.
Fuse block is faulty.
Neutral switch is out of adjustment or is faulty.
TEC controller is faulty.
